[XeTeX] segfault with xetex
Jonathan Kew
jonathan_kew at sil.org
Fri Aug 25 15:28:44 CEST 2006
On 25 Aug 2006, at 1:32 pm, Pablo Rodríguez wrote:
>>
>> Of course, any segfault is a bug at some level.... usually because of
>> some unexpected situation where the code doesn't handle an error
>> condition properly. So it would be good to identify exactly what's
>> happening. I'm not sure what you mean by "\setromanfont has no system
>> font", though. Your document says \setromanfont{Epigraphica}, I
>> guess; so what Epigraphica fonts are installed, and where?
>
> Epigraphica is actually a typo, the installed font is actually
> Epigrafica (http://myria.math.aegean.gr/labs/dt/fonts-en.html). What I
> meant is that my system has no font with this family name.
I notice that the naming in those fonts is actually a bit
inconsistent; the "ph" form occurs in some of the names within the
fonts. Perhaps they decided to change it at some point during
development, but didn't fix all occurrences. However, I don't think
that necessarily explains the crash you're seeing.
Do you get the same crash if you enter a completely "junk" font name,
like \setromanfont{MyBadFontName}? How about if you try a simple
\font command like \font\x="SillyNonExistentFontName" at 12pt ? Or
does it only happen with the "ph" typo for Epigrafica?
JK
More information about the XeTeX
mailing list